This article discusses how moisture can hinder dustcollector performance and the causes of moisture indust collection systems. The article also explains howmonitoring airstream temperatures in your dustcollection system can help you prevent moistureproblems and describes methods for dryingcompressed air for reverse pulse-jet cleaning systems. moisture can be very disruptive to a dustcollection system. Dust collector filter mediatends to become plugged with material whenwet, particularly if the dust is hygroscopic and absorbswater. The dust-liquid mixture clogs the pores in thefilter media, creating an impermeable coating that canresist most types of filter cleaning systems.
